Project Type Typical Range
Basic Water Softening $1,200 - $2,800
Reverse Osmosis System $2,500 - $6,500
Whole House Filtration $3,000 - $7,000
Ultraviolet Disinfection $1,500 - $4,000
Water Testing & Analysis $200 - $800
System Installation $1,500 - $5,000

Key Cost Considerations

Water treatment services in Skippack, PA, typically involve assessing local water quality and installing systems that improve water safety and taste. Projects can vary based on the size of the property and specific water issues, such as hardness or contaminants. Understanding the scope and options can help in planning and budgeting for water treatment needs.

  • Materials used range from carbon filters to reverse osmosis systems, depending on water quality concerns.
  • Project size can vary from small point-of-use filters to entire-home treatment systems.
  • Labor complexity depends on system type, installation location, and existing plumbing infrastructure.
  • Permitting requirements may be needed for certain system installations, especially larger or more complex setups.
  • Additional features like mineral enhancement or UV sterilization can be included as extras.
